Contact Us
Our Address
336 Office Plaza Drive, Tallahassee, FL 32301
See "Meet Our Team" here for stylist and contact information.

Our Address
336 Office Plaza Drive, Tallahassee, FL 32301
See "Meet Our Team" here for stylist and contact information.